Background Information
The novel and then there were none was first published in 1939 and has since become a classic of the mystery genre․
The story takes place on a remote island where ten strangers are invited for a weekend‚ only to be killed off one by one․
The novel’s author‚ Agatha Christie‚ is known for her clever plots and unexpected twists‚ and and then there were none is no exception․
The book has been widely acclaimed for its suspenseful and engaging storyline‚ and has been translated into numerous languages․

The novel’s themes of guilt‚ justice‚ and the nature of humanity are still widely discussed and debated today․
The book’s impact on popular culture is also significant‚ with references to the story appearing in countless films‚ TV shows‚ and books․
